This package contains essential legal documents for Military Personnel who desire to address important legal issues as they prepare for active duty.The documents in this package are State Specific and include the following:

1.) A Will that meets your specific needs;
2.) A Health Care Proxy including Living Will provisions;
3.) A Military General Power of Attorney;
4.) A Financial Statement for an Individual;
5.) Personal Planning Information and Document Inventory Worksheets;
6.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Automobile Sale;
7.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Automobile Shipment;
8.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Rental Lease;
9.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Rental Property Management;
10.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Automobile Use and Registration;
11.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Banking;
12.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Child Medical;
13.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Household goods;
14.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for In Loco Parentis; and
15.) A Special Military Power of Attorney for Outprocessing.

New York Legal Life Without Parole: A Comprehensive Overview Introduction: New York legal life without parole refers to a sentencing option within the criminal justice system that allows individuals convicted of serious crimes to be imprisoned for the remainder of their lives, with no possibility of release. This article aims to provide a detailed description of New York legal life without parole, including its definition, application, and various types. Definition and Application: Life without parole, also known as LOOP, is a severe punishment imposed on individuals convicted of heinous crimes in New York. Unlike traditional life sentences, where the possibility of parole after a certain period exists, life without parole ensures that the offender will spend the entirety of their life behind bars. To impose this sentence, the court considers the severity and nature of the crime committed. Offenses that often warrant life without parole include first-degree murder, felony murder, aggravated murder, terrorism-related crimes resulting in death, multiple homicides, and other extremely violent or egregious acts. Types of New York Legal Life Without Parole: While the term "life without parole" generally implies a single sentencing option, there are several types of life without parole sentences in New York that vary based on the offender's age when the crime was committed. 1. Juvenile Life Without Parole (LOOP): This type of life without parole applies to individuals who committed their crimes under the age of 18. However, recent legal developments in New York, specifically through the 2019 state law, prohibit the imposition of LOOP, making it no longer an applicable sentencing option. 2. Adult Life Without Parole: Adult offenders aged 18 or older at the time of committing a serious crime can be sentenced to adult life without parole. This type of sentence is reserved for the most severe cases, such as premeditated murder or repeated violent offenses. Impacts and Controversies: The implementation of life without parole as a sentencing option in New York has sparked substantial debate and remains a topic of controversy. Advocates argue that it serves as an effective deterrent against serious crimes, protects society from dangerous individuals, and provides justice to the victims and their families. However, opponents question the proportionality of the punishment, emphasizing human rights concerns, the potential for wrongful convictions, and the lack of hope or opportunity for offenders' rehabilitation. Conclusion: New York legal life without parole serves as an extreme punishment for individuals convicted of heinous crimes. It ensures that offenders, both juvenile and adult, found guilty of the most severe offenses, face a lifetime of incarceration without the chance of release. Despite the controversies surrounding this sentencing option, it remains within the purview of the New York criminal justice system to deliver what it deems fair and just punishment for the most egregious crimes committed in the state.
